MP Board · Class 11 · Physics · GravitationThe value of acceleration due to gravity ($g$) at the centre of the Earth is:

Step-by-Step Solution

At a depth $d = R$ (centre of the Earth), $g' = g\left(1 - \frac{d}{R}\right) = g\left(1 - \frac{R}{R}\right) = 0$.
